Fibrillation will start off as increased heartrate which will slowly increase. Once increase heartrate reaches 100%, the victim will enter fibrillation, and symptoms will start.
Caused by:
Causes:
- Cardiac Arrest (at 20% or more)
- Hypotension (at 100%)
Treatments:
-
Treating the causes
-
Adrenaline (slows down fibrillation)
-
Manual Defibrillator or Automated External Defibrillator (AED)
